Johannes Karl von und zu Franckenstein (1610–1691) was the Prince-Bishop of Worms from 1683 to 1691.
[1] A member of the House of Franckenstein, Johannes Karl von und zu Franckenstein was born in Castle Frankenstein in 1610.
[1] Pope Innocent XI confirmed his appointment on 16 July 1688 and he was consecrated as a bishop by Anselm Franz von Ingelheim, Archbishop-Elector of Mainz, on 5 September 1688.
[1] He died on 29 September 1691 and is buried in Frankfurt Cathedral.
